mirror of
https://github.com/keanuplayz/TravBot-v3.git
synced 2024-08-15 02:33:12 +00:00
[eco] Undid accidental reverts
as reported by @Hades785
This commit is contained in:
parent
0e66735565
commit
ad82aef396
3 changed files with 24 additions and 9 deletions
|
@ -5,6 +5,7 @@ export default new NamedCommand({
|
||||||
channelType: CHANNEL_TYPE.GUILD,
|
channelType: CHANNEL_TYPE.GUILD,
|
||||||
async run({send, guild}) {
|
async run({send, guild}) {
|
||||||
const member = guild!.members.cache.random();
|
const member = guild!.members.cache.random();
|
||||||
send(`I love ${member.nickname ?? member.user.username}!`);
|
if (!member) return send("For some reason, an error occurred fetching a member.");
|
||||||
|
return send(`I love ${member.nickname ?? member.user.username}!`);
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
|
|
|
@ -1,3 +1,4 @@
|
||||||
|
import {TextChannel} from "discord.js";
|
||||||
import {Command, getUserByNickname, NamedCommand, confirm, RestCommand} from "onion-lasers";
|
import {Command, getUserByNickname, NamedCommand, confirm, RestCommand} from "onion-lasers";
|
||||||
import {pluralise} from "../../../lib";
|
import {pluralise} from "../../../lib";
|
||||||
import {Storage} from "../../../structures";
|
import {Storage} from "../../../structures";
|
||||||
|
@ -20,7 +21,13 @@ export const DailyCommand = new NamedCommand({
|
||||||
{
|
{
|
||||||
title: "Daily Reward",
|
title: "Daily Reward",
|
||||||
description: "You received 1 Mon!",
|
description: "You received 1 Mon!",
|
||||||
color: ECO_EMBED_COLOR
|
color: ECO_EMBED_COLOR,
|
||||||
|
fields: [
|
||||||
|
{
|
||||||
|
name: "New balance:",
|
||||||
|
value: pluralise(user.money, "Mon", "s")
|
||||||
|
}
|
||||||
|
]
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
});
|
});
|
||||||
|
@ -29,10 +36,9 @@ export const DailyCommand = new NamedCommand({
|
||||||
embeds: [
|
embeds: [
|
||||||
{
|
{
|
||||||
title: "Daily Reward",
|
title: "Daily Reward",
|
||||||
description: `It's too soon to pick up your daily Mons. You have about ${(
|
description: `It's too soon to pick up your daily Mons. Try again at <t:${Math.floor(
|
||||||
(user.lastReceived + 79200000 - now) /
|
(user.lastReceived + 79200000) / 1000
|
||||||
3600000
|
)}:t>.`,
|
||||||
).toFixed(1)} hours to go.`,
|
|
||||||
color: ECO_EMBED_COLOR
|
color: ECO_EMBED_COLOR
|
||||||
}
|
}
|
||||||
]
|
]
|
||||||
|
|
|
@ -62,9 +62,17 @@ export function getSendEmbed(sender: User, receiver: User, amount: number): obje
|
||||||
}
|
}
|
||||||
|
|
||||||
export function isAuthorized(guild: Guild | null, channel: TextBasedChannels): boolean {
|
export function isAuthorized(guild: Guild | null, channel: TextBasedChannels): boolean {
|
||||||
if ((guild?.id === "637512823676600330" && channel?.id === "669464416420364288") || IS_DEV_MODE) return true;
|
if (IS_DEV_MODE) {
|
||||||
else {
|
return true;
|
||||||
channel.send("Sorry, this command can only be used in Monika's emote server. (#mon-stocks)");
|
}
|
||||||
|
|
||||||
|
if (guild?.id !== "637512823676600330") {
|
||||||
|
channel.send("Sorry, this command can only be used in Monika's emote server.");
|
||||||
|
return false;
|
||||||
|
} else if (channel?.id !== "669464416420364288") {
|
||||||
|
channel.send("Sorry, this command can only be used in <#669464416420364288>.");
|
||||||
|
return false;
|
||||||
|
} else {
|
||||||
return false;
|
return false;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in a new issue